LAHORE (Dunya News) – A Kalat resident Deepak Kumar who worked as Indian spy has made startling revelations including his visit to New Delhi in 2014 and being convinced by Indian army officers to spy for them, Dunya News reported.

According to details, the detained Indian spy has confessed that he used to work for India and went to Yatra in 2014 where two Indian army officers met him at the visa office and offered visa extension in exchange for spying for them.

He said he was paid Rs 50,000 while his brother residing in India was paid Rs 4.5 lakh. The full interview of the detained spy will be aired tonight at 10 on the show Mahaaz only on Dunya News.


RAW planning attacks on PM, Hafiz Saeed: Home Ministry Punjab


Indian intelligence agency Research and Analysis Wing (RAW) is planning attacks on Prime Minister Nawaz Sharif and Hafiz Saeed, warned the Home Ministry of Punjab on Saturday. The ministry has directed for tighter security for VVIPs and PM Nawaz, reported Dunya News.

In a letter sent to Law Enforcement Agencies (LEAs) by Interior Ministry of Punjab, that the notorious intelligence agency of India, RAW, is planning to target PM Nawaz Sharif and chief of Jamat-ud-Dawa (JuD). In order to execute the plan, Tehreek-e-Taliban and Lashkar-e-Jhangvi (LeJ) might be mobilized by RAW, stated the letter.

Interior Ministry has sent Inter Services Intelligence (ISI), Military Intelligence (MI), Intelligence Bureau (IB) and Secretary of the Prime Minister have been sent copies of the letter.

LEAs have directed to tighten security of both personalities by the Home Ministry of Punjab.
